Quality problems are the silent killer of conversion. A broken checkout button that affects 10% of mobile users is invisible to you (you tested in Chrome on desktop) but costs real money. The QA Automation Engineer audits the rendered output of your site for the kinds of issues automated browser tests would catch.

A real example
You ask: Audit my plumbing site for broken links, accessibility issues, and form problems.
What you get back: A QA report. Examples: "Critical: 7 internal links return 404 - mostly old blog posts removed without redirect", "High: contact form submit button has no visible focus state - keyboard users get stuck", "Medium: 14 images missing alt text", "Low: 3 paragraphs have insufficient color contrast (4.1:1 vs 4.5:1 required)". With remediation guidance per issue.

Does this catch all accessibility issues?
It catches the common automatable ones (alt text, contrast, labels, focus states). Some accessibility issues require human review (cognitive load, screen-reader flow); for those, hire an accessibility consultant.
